Where Did the Tree of Liberty Image Originate?

The precise origins of the Tree of Liberty image are difficult to pinpoint, as the metaphor itself dates back centuries. However, its popularization in the context of American political thought is strongly linked to the American Revolution. The phrase "The Tree of Liberty must be refreshed from time to time with the blood of patriots and tyrants," attributed to Thomas Jefferson (though its exact authenticity is debated), highlights the sometimes violent struggle necessary to maintain and reclaim liberty. This quote, along with its visual representation, came to represent the sacrifices made for freedom and the ongoing need for vigilance.
